1

Omegle download

News Discuss 
In the vast digital landscape with the internet, few platforms have were able to capture the curiosity and engagement of users comparable to Omegle. Launched in '09, Omegle can be a free online chat platform that connects users from worldwide in random, anonymous conversations. Whether through text or video, Omegle https://k12.instructure.com/eportfolios/920926/home/exploring-the-world-of-omegle-chat-a-modern-social-phenomenon

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story